Auto Repair & Maintenance : How to Replace Headlight Bulbs
Replace car headlight bulbs by removing the headlight covering, taking off the electrical connector, unlocking the headlight ring and taking out the bulb. Use the reverse procedure to put in a new car headlight bulb with help from a certified master mechanic in this free video on auto repair.

Very helpful video. The electrical connector can be a little stubborn. On my ’97 Accord, I pressed the clip in with one hand and then simultaneously lightly struck the connector with a flat head screwdriver with the other hand.
the electrical connector does NOT come off that easily… I had to remove my battery in order to get enough room to do some MAJOR, finger-breaking pulling apart. It’d be nice if you mentioned that difficulty varies.
